This release has been updated by the Williamsburg Police Department: 34-year-old Cara Lawson of Williamsburg, has been sentenced to prison for her involvement in a drug trafficking investigation in January and March of 2022.
Lawson was convicted in Whitley Circuit Court on January 12, 2023, on two counts of trafficking in Methamphetamine, one count of trafficking fentanyl, and one count of promoting contraband. She was one of six defendants in two separate drug trafficking investigations where she possessed thirty grams of methamphetamine in one case and over three-hundred grams of methamphetamine and a small quantity of fentanyl in another case. Each count carried (5) years and was to be served concurrently.
The incidents were investigated by WPD and DEA-London. The cases were successfully prosecuted by the Office of the Whitley County Commonwealth’s Attorney. The other defendants involved in the cases have not been resolved and are awaiting trial.
